当用户需要对文章做预设主题排版并生成可复制到公众号的预览链接时:输入是用户的 Markdown 文件,本技能只产出 预设主题渲染版 的预览链接(不做 AI 结构化预览)。
article.md),希望用主题/版式快速美化并复制到公众号后台。article.md 或用户指定的 .md 路径)。https://edit.shiker.tech/copy.html?id=xxx),即预设主题渲染版。执行本技能时必须在用户 Markdown 同目录(或约定工作目录)产出以下文件,缺一不可:
| 产物 | 说明 | 约定路径/文件名 |
|---|---|---|
| -------------- | ------------------------------------------ | ------------------------ |
| 预设主题 HTML | 使用主题/版式(或 preset)将 Markdown 渲染为公众号可复制 HTML | article.preset.html |
| 含预览地址的 txt | 包含预设主题版的预览链接,以脚本输出为准,便于用户直接打开 | wechat-preview-url.txt |
--preset)或主题/版式(--theme + --layout)对 Markdown 做主题渲染,得到 article.preset.html。edit.shiker.tech/api/copy,得到一条预览链接。wechat-preview-url.txt 为准(勿让 AI 自行"转述"链接,否则长 id 易漏数字导致链接错误);用户浏览器打开 → 点击「复制到剪贴板」→ 粘贴到公众号后台。article.preset.html)与 含预览地址的 txt(wechat-preview-url.txt),详见上文「技能产物(必交)」表。wechat-copy.js(推荐):输入一个 .md,生成预设主题 HTML + 单条预览链接,并在 md 同目录写入 article.preset.html 与 wechat-preview-url.txt。wechat-html.js:仅从 Markdown 生成预设主题 HTML(不请求预览链接)。本技能仅做预设主题渲染(PRESET),不区分“格式一/格式二”。你只需要按文章气质选择 --preset(或 --theme + --layout)即可。
| 文章类型/气质 | 推荐选择 | 说明 |
|---|---|---|
| --- | --- | --- |
| 资讯密集(早报/周报/速读) | 优先用 --preset <预设名> | 更强调层级与可扫读性。 |
| 深度长文(复盘/观点/教程) | 优先用 --preset <预设名> | 更强调段落节奏与引用块。 |
| 通知/公告(偏正式) | 用 --theme 微调 | 方便固定到一套“公司风格”组合。 |
| 追求稳定一致(团队长期复用) | 固定一个 --preset 或固定 --theme/--layout | 所有人使用同一组合,输出风格一致。 |
查看可用预设/主题/版式:
node wechat-html.js --list-presetsnode wechat-html.js --list-themesnode wechat-html.js --list-layoutsPOST https://edit.shiker.tech/api/copyContent-Type: application/json,{ "html": "完整 HTML 字符串" }{ success: true, data: { id, url } };url 即为预览页地址。wechat-preview-url.txt 中的链接为准;若 AI 提供了链接,请与上述文件内容核对。node wechat-copy.js (可选加 --preset 或 --theme/--layout)。article.preset.html 与 wechat-preview-url.txt。共 5 个版本